Peppertype.ai and Sglang both offer freemium pricing models and have similar overall scores, with Peppertype.ai at 5.4/10 and Sglang at 5.3/10. Peppertype.ai focuses on generating diverse content types such as blog ideas, social media posts, and product descriptions, catering primarily to marketers and content creators. Sglang, meanwhile, emphasizes language translation and multilingual content generation, targeting users needing cross-language communication and localization.
